Ticket: Unlock migration vault for Ironvine ORM refactor

New team members: the legacy Ironvine ORM layer is being replaced module by module, and the schema snapshots needed for safe refactoring sit in a locked vault nobody has opened since the last owner left. We recovered the credentials from escrow this week. The passphrase follows below.

unlock words, kajog-yawip: istwyn-casath-aldok

TICKET-4412: Vault locked during queue migration

While replacing the homegrown job queue (Crankshaft) with Relaybox, the deploy user's vault at Hollis Systems got sealed after three failed unseal attempts. Migration is paused until the vault is reopened; worker credentials for the new queue live there. Future maintainers: do not rotate the unseal keys mid-migration again. To unseal, use the recovery passphrase below.

vault phrase of taweg-kafof = oliax-zorael

Uploaded text files in Corvetta pass through the charset-sniffing service before parsing; detection results are signed to prevent tampering downstream. The signing routine reads its key from the environment at startup and refuses to boot without it. Add the following line to the detector's .env file:

secret setting of hawep-yahig: LEDGER_TOKEN29=41b5d6315371c92885eaeb077fb63

Handover note — Marit to Osric, re: Widespan diff viewer. Plugin authors should know the chunked-rendering API now streams hunks above 200 MB; hooks registered via onHunkReady fire per chunk, not per file. Test fixtures live in the sandbox tenant. To unlock the sandbox signing keystore that plugin builds require, enter the recovery passphrase printed directly below this note.

unlock words, yawig-kagef: gordor-holvan-ulaael-pramir-ulaiel-tamdor